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Docs: add faq #2527

Merged
merged 1 commit into from
Jul 24, 2024
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
61 changes: 61 additions & 0 deletions docs/docs/guide/faq.md
Original file line number Diff line number Diff line change
@@ -0,0 +1,61 @@
---
sidebar_position: 5
---
# よくある質問
よくある質問をまとめておきました。こちらに掲載のない質問がある場合は、お気軽に[サポートサーバー](https://sr.usamyon.moe/8QZw)までお問い合わせください。

## Q. 音楽ボットがどんなものなのか知りたいので、ためしに使用することはできますか?
A. [サポートサーバー](https://sr.usamyon.moe/8QZw)では、音楽ボットを試しに使ってみることが可能ですので、ぜひご参加ください。

## Q. ボットの動かし方がよくわからないのですが、自分のサーバーで音楽ボットを使うことはできますか?
A. 開発者は、誰でも使えるボットを公開していませんが、有志の方々によって誰でも導入できるようになっているボットがあります。これを「公開インスタンス」といい、[サポートサーバー](https://sr.usamyon.moe/8QZw)内でご案内しております。ぜひご活用ください。

:::note
公開インスタンスを利用する際には、それぞれのボットの提供者による個別の利用規約やプライバシーポリシー等が適用されることがあります。詳細な利用条件等はそれぞれの公開インスタンスの提供者までお問い合わせください。
:::

## Q. 音楽ボットの音質が悪いです
A. 音楽ボットの音質が悪いのは、端末が原因のことが多くあります。開発者の経験では、iPad や Android のスマホやタブレットで利用した際には、非常に音質が悪くなっていました。他の環境はわかりませんが、他の環境でも音質が悪くなることが多々あるようです。これは、Discord のボイスチャンネルの接続が会話に最適化されている影響と思われます。

開発者自身の経験では、ボットの音質は、PC のアプリ環境が最もよく感じられます。Windows や Mac などの PC で、Discord のデスクトップアプリをインストールの上、有線イヤホンやスピーカーでご利用いただくのが簡単に一番音質が良く感じられると思います。

開発者は Mac の環境がないのでわかりませんが、Windows の PC の場合、ワイヤレスイヤホン・ヘッドホンをご利用いただく場合も音質が落ちることが分かっています。この場合、デバイスマネージャーから、ワイヤレスイヤホン・ヘッドホンのハンズフリー通話機能を無効化することで大幅に改善しますが、ワイヤレスイヤホンに搭載されているマイクが動作しなくなる欠点も存在します。(こちらの方法について気になる方は、サポートサーバーまでお気軽にお越しください。)

ボイスチャンネルの音質をサーバーブーストによってあげるという解決策が色々な記事などで紹介されていますが、上で紹介したことが原因であった場合、ブーストしても改善しません。

:::note
デフォルトのビットレート設定である64kbpsで、音楽がどのように聞こえるのかは、こちらのサンプル音声で確認いただけます。
実際の環境とは条件が異なりますが、参考にして下さい。

<audio src="https://static-objects.usamyon.moe/dsmb/docs-assets/saegiraretatsuki_48kHz_64kbps.wav" controls controlslist="nodownload" preload="metadata" />

※音源:[ノスタルジア「遮られた月」](http://nostalgiamusic.info/music_saegiraretatsuki.html)
※元音源を、48kHz・64kbpsのwebm/opusに変換後、wavファイルに変換したものです。
:::

## Q. 再生すると、速度が速くなったり遅くなったりします
A. ボットが動作しているサーバーのスペックやネットワークの問題かと思われます。申し訳ございませんが、ボット側で対応できることはございません。

## Q. プレフィックスがわからなくなりました
A. ボットに設定されているプレフィックスがわからなくなってしまった場合、単にボットをメンションすることで、プレフィックスを表示することができますので、ご確認ください。
なお、スラッシュコマンドのみのモードになっている場合、プレフィックスは表示されません。

## Q. バグかもしれない現象を発見しました
A. ボットの提供者の方がサポートサーバーなどサポート窓口を設置している場合、そちらにお問い合わせください。窓口がない場合でも、ボットの管理者の方にまずは連絡を取ることをお勧めします。当ボットのサポートサーバーにお越しいただいても構いませんが、状況によっては対応できないことがあります。

## Q. バージョンが、`Could not get version`となっています
A. ボットが動作しているサーバーで、`git`が正しくインストールされていません。ボットの管理者の方にお問い合わせください。

## Q. ボットについての記事を書くのは大丈夫ですか?
A. 全く問題ありません。歓迎いたします。ありがとうございます。執筆していただいた記事等は、サポートサーバー内で紹介させていただくことがございます。

## Q. Linuxなどでもボットを動かせますか?
A. どの環境であっても、必ず動作するという保証はできませんが、Linux など Node.js が動作する環境であれば動作するはずです。

## Q. このボットがほかのボットに比べて優れている点はなんですか?
A. 他のボットにはないユニークな機能(ラジオ機能やフレーム機能など)が搭載されている点です。ボットをご自身の環境で動かしている方(ホストしている方)にとっては、外部のサービスやアプリなど(Lavalinkサーバーなど)を追加で設定する必要がないため、簡単にセットアップが可能な点が優れていると考えています。

## Q. どうして discord.js を使っていないのですか?
A. discord.js はメジャーアップデートのたびに破壊的な変更が多く、アップデートごとに疲弊するという問題があります。また、モジュールが肥大である点、JavaScriptでのボット開発はサポートされているのにstrictモードでないTypeScriptでのボット開発がサポート外である点が挙げられます。
oceanic.js は、discord.js ほどの知名度はありませんが、APIが比較的安定している点、Discord API の変更に素早く追従する点、モジュールが肥大でない点などから、本ボットでは oceanic.js を採用しています。
なお、過去のメジャーバージョンでは、discord.js や eris を採用していた時期もありました。
61 changes: 61 additions & 0 deletions docs/versioned_docs/version-v4.3/guide/faq.md
Original file line number Diff line number Diff line change
@@ -0,0 +1,61 @@
---
sidebar_position: 5
---
# よくある質問
よくある質問をまとめておきました。こちらに掲載のない質問がある場合は、お気軽に[サポートサーバー](https://sr.usamyon.moe/8QZw)までお問い合わせください。

## Q. 音楽ボットがどんなものなのか知りたいので、ためしに使用することはできますか?
A. [サポートサーバー](https://sr.usamyon.moe/8QZw)では、音楽ボットを試しに使ってみることが可能ですので、ぜひご参加ください。

## Q. ボットの動かし方がよくわからないのですが、自分のサーバーで音楽ボットを使うことはできますか?
A. 開発者は、誰でも使えるボットを公開していませんが、有志の方々によって誰でも導入できるようになっているボットがあります。これを「公開インスタンス」といい、[サポートサーバー](https://sr.usamyon.moe/8QZw)内でご案内しております。ぜひご活用ください。

:::note
公開インスタンスを利用する際には、それぞれのボットの提供者による個別の利用規約やプライバシーポリシー等が適用されることがあります。詳細な利用条件等はそれぞれの公開インスタンスの提供者までお問い合わせください。
:::

## Q. 音楽ボットの音質が悪いです
A. 音楽ボットの音質が悪いのは、端末が原因のことが多くあります。開発者の経験では、iPad や Android のスマホやタブレットで利用した際には、非常に音質が悪くなっていました。他の環境はわかりませんが、他の環境でも音質が悪くなることが多々あるようです。これは、Discord のボイスチャンネルの接続が会話に最適化されている影響と思われます。

開発者自身の経験では、ボットの音質は、PC のアプリ環境が最もよく感じられます。Windows や Mac などの PC で、Discord のデスクトップアプリをインストールの上、有線イヤホンやスピーカーでご利用いただくのが簡単に一番音質が良く感じられると思います。

開発者は Mac の環境がないのでわかりませんが、Windows の PC の場合、ワイヤレスイヤホン・ヘッドホンをご利用いただく場合も音質が落ちることが分かっています。この場合、デバイスマネージャーから、ワイヤレスイヤホン・ヘッドホンのハンズフリー通話機能を無効化することで大幅に改善しますが、ワイヤレスイヤホンに搭載されているマイクが動作しなくなる欠点も存在します。(こちらの方法について気になる方は、サポートサーバーまでお気軽にお越しください。)

ボイスチャンネルの音質をサーバーブーストによってあげるという解決策が色々な記事などで紹介されていますが、上で紹介したことが原因であった場合、ブーストしても改善しません。

:::note
デフォルトのビットレート設定である64kbpsで、音楽がどのように聞こえるのかは、こちらのサンプル音声で確認いただけます。
実際の環境とは条件が異なりますが、参考にして下さい。

<audio src="https://static-objects.usamyon.moe/dsmb/docs-assets/saegiraretatsuki_48kHz_64kbps.wav" controls controlslist="nodownload" preload="metadata" />

※音源:[ノスタルジア「遮られた月」](http://nostalgiamusic.info/music_saegiraretatsuki.html)
※元音源を、48kHz・64kbpsのwebm/opusに変換後、wavファイルに変換したものです。
:::

## Q. 再生すると、速度が速くなったり遅くなったりします
A. ボットが動作しているサーバーのスペックやネットワークの問題かと思われます。申し訳ございませんが、ボット側で対応できることはございません。

## Q. プレフィックスがわからなくなりました
A. ボットに設定されているプレフィックスがわからなくなってしまった場合、単にボットをメンションすることで、プレフィックスを表示することができますので、ご確認ください。
なお、スラッシュコマンドのみのモードになっている場合、プレフィックスは表示されません。

## Q. バグかもしれない現象を発見しました
A. ボットの提供者の方がサポートサーバーなどサポート窓口を設置している場合、そちらにお問い合わせください。窓口がない場合でも、ボットの管理者の方にまずは連絡を取ることをお勧めします。当ボットのサポートサーバーにお越しいただいても構いませんが、状況によっては対応できないことがあります。

## Q. バージョンが、`Could not get version`となっています
A. ボットが動作しているサーバーで、`git`が正しくインストールされていません。ボットの管理者の方にお問い合わせください。

## Q. ボットについての記事を書くのは大丈夫ですか?
A. 全く問題ありません。歓迎いたします。ありがとうございます。執筆していただいた記事等は、サポートサーバー内で紹介させていただくことがございます。

## Q. Linuxなどでもボットを動かせますか?
A. どの環境であっても、必ず動作するという保証はできませんが、Linux など Node.js が動作する環境であれば動作するはずです。

## Q. このボットがほかのボットに比べて優れている点はなんですか?
A. 他のボットにはないユニークな機能(ラジオ機能やフレーム機能など)が搭載されている点です。ボットをご自身の環境で動かしている方(ホストしている方)にとっては、外部のサービスやアプリなど(Lavalinkサーバーなど)を追加で設定する必要がないため、簡単にセットアップが可能な点が優れていると考えています。

## Q. どうして discord.js を使っていないのですか?
A. discord.js はメジャーアップデートのたびに破壊的な変更が多く、アップデートごとに疲弊するという問題があります。また、モジュールが肥大である点、JavaScriptでのボット開発はサポートされているのにstrictモードでないTypeScriptでのボット開発がサポート外である点が挙げられます。
oceanic.js は、discord.js ほどの知名度はありませんが、APIが比較的安定している点、Discord API の変更に素早く追従する点、モジュールが肥大でない点などから、本ボットでは oceanic.js を採用しています。
なお、過去のメジャーバージョンでは、discord.js や eris を採用していた時期もありました。